The digital marketing ecosystem has evolved dramatically, shifting from simple keyword matching to a complex interplay of technical health, content relevance, and now, AI-driven search interfaces. For professionals seeking to dominate search results, understanding the available software is no longer optional—it is the foundation of strategy. An SEO tool, as defined by industry experts, is a platform designed to plan and strategize ways to improve a site's visibility not just in traditional search engines like Google and Bing, but also in generative AI engines such as ChatGPT and Perplexity. These platforms serve as the navigational instruments for digital campaigns, offering insights that range from keyword search volumes to the technical architecture of a website.
The sheer volume of options can be paralyzing. Some tools aim to be comprehensive ecosystems, handling everything from site audits to rank tracking, while others specialize in a single, high-precision function like backlink analysis or content optimization. The choice of which tool to utilize often depends on the specific stage of the SEO workflow, the budget constraints of the organization, and the technical proficiency of the user. For instance, a beginner might find immense value in the free utilities provided by search engines themselves, while an enterprise-level agency requires robust, scalable platforms to manage hundreds of clients. As we move further into 2025, the integration of artificial intelligence into these workflows has become a central theme, making tools that offer automation and data-driven decision-making more valuable than ever. Understanding the taxonomy of these tools and their specific use cases is the first step toward building a resilient and high-performing digital presence.
The All-in-One Powerhouses
In the realm of SEO software, "all-in-one" platforms represent the heavy artillery. These tools are designed to consolidate a vast array of SEO tasks into a single dashboard, eliminating the need to switch between multiple disparate applications. They are the go-to choice for marketing teams and agencies that require a holistic view of their digital performance. According to multiple industry analyses, Semrush stands out as the premier example in this category. It is described as an all-in-one tool for organic marketing, encompassing SEO, AI Search, and PPC (Pay-Per-Click) advertising. With a subscriber base exceeding 12 million, including many leading brands, Semrush provides a comprehensive suite of features that includes robust keyword research, detailed site audits, backlink analysis, rank tracking, and competitor monitoring.
The primary advantage of an all-in-one tool is the synergy it creates between different data points. For example, a user can identify a high-value keyword through the keyword research module, analyze the competitor's content ranking for that term, audit their own site for technical deficiencies preventing them from ranking, and track their position over time—all within the same ecosystem. This integration is crucial for developing data-driven decisions and scaling content production intelligently. While Semrush is the top pick for many, other tools in this category offer similar, albeit slightly different, value propositions. Ahrefs is frequently mentioned alongside Semrush as a favorite for keyword research and competitor analysis. These platforms often come with a higher price tag, starting from around $139.95 per month, but they offer a limited free plan or trial period, allowing users to test their capabilities before committing. For businesses serious about dominating search rankings, investing in a comprehensive platform is often the most efficient path forward.
Comparing Top All-in-One Platforms
To better understand the offerings of these comprehensive tools, it is helpful to compare their core features and target audiences. The following table breaks down the key attributes of the market leaders.
| Tool Name | Core Strengths | Pricing Model | Ideal User |
|---|---|---|---|
| Semrush | All-in-one SEO, AI Search visibility, PPC management, keyword research, site audits, backlink analysis, competitor monitoring. | Starts at $139.95/month; limited free plan. | Growing businesses, agencies, enterprise-level marketers. |
| Ahrefs | Keyword research, competitor backlink analysis, site explorer, content explorer. | Subscription-based; known for extensive backlink database. | SEO specialists, content marketers, agencies focused on link building. |
Choosing the right all-in-one platform depends on specific needs. If the primary goal is to manage the entire SEO workflow, including PPC and social media, Semrush is the logical choice. If the focus is heavily on backlink analysis and understanding the competitive landscape through link profiles, Ahrefs is often cited as the superior tool. Both represent a significant step up from basic tools and provide the depth of data necessary to compete in saturated markets.
Specialized Tools for Niche SEO Tasks
While all-in-one platforms are powerful, they can sometimes lack the depth required for highly specialized tasks. This is where niche tools come into play. These are applications designed to perform a specific function exceptionally well, often providing features that are more advanced than what is found in a generalized suite. The SEO workflow is complex, involving distinct stages such as keyword research, content creation, technical auditing, and link building. Specialized tools allow professionals to apply the best-in-class solution to each stage of this process.
For keyword research and intent mapping, tools like Keyword Insights are invaluable. This platform goes beyond simple search volume metrics, offering advanced keyword clustering and intent mapping capabilities. This means it can group keywords by topic and determine the user's underlying goal (e.g., informational, transactional, navigational), which is critical for creating content that satisfies both the user and the search engine. Similarly, Exploding Topics is a specialized tool for trend identification. It helps marketers spot rising trends before they peak, providing a first-mover advantage in content creation. In the competitive world of link building, a tool like Featured connects experts with journalists seeking quotes, helping to secure high-authority, journalist-style backlinks.
The Role of Chrome Extensions
A sub-category of specialized tools that has gained immense popularity is the Chrome extension. These lightweight tools provide on-the-fly data directly within the browser, usually on search engine results pages (SERPs) or while browsing a competitor's website. They are perfect for quick, ad-hoc analysis without the need to log into a full-fledged platform.
- Detailed: A lightweight and reliable SEO Chrome extension for quick on-page checks. It provides immediate insights into meta tags, headings, and other on-page elements.
- Keywords Everywhere: This tool aggregates data from various sources like Google Trends and Search Console to display keyword search volume, cost-per-click, and competition data directly on the SERP. It is praised for simplifying the brainstorming process for blog topics.
- Fatrank: A niche rank tracking extension. An SEO expert from Project Build Construction highlights Fatrank as a "lifesaver" for its ability to instantly show the ranking position of the current URL for any search query typed in, providing live and accurate data for client reporting.
These tools excel at providing rapid feedback and streamlining specific, repetitive tasks. For example, an SEO professional can use Keywords Everywhere to validate a content idea's search potential while simultaneously using Detailed to analyze the on-page optimization of the top-ranking pages, all within a few clicks.
Free and Freemium Tools: A Solid Foundation
A common misconception is that effective SEO requires a substantial financial investment. In reality, some of the most powerful tools available are free, provided directly by the search engines themselves. For beginners, starting with these tools is not only cost-effective but also strategically sound, as they provide data straight from the source. The most critical of these are the Google tools.
- Google Search Console (GSC): The bedrock of technical SEO. GSC provides essential data on how a site is performing in Google Search, including indexing status, crawl errors, mobile usability issues, and search query performance (clicks, impressions, CTR).
- Google Keyword Planner: Primarily designed for PPC advertisers, this tool is also excellent for keyword research, offering search volume estimates and keyword ideas.
- Google Trends: Shows the popularity of a search term over time, helping to identify seasonal trends or rising interest in a particular topic.
- Google Autocomplete: A simple yet effective method for generating long-tail keyword ideas by observing the suggestions Google provides as you type in the search bar.
Beyond the Google ecosystem, there are "freemium" tools that offer a functional free tier, with the option to upgrade for more features. Screaming Frog SEO Spider is a prime example. Its free version allows for crawling up to 500 URLs, making it a powerful tool for auditing small to medium-sized websites. It diagnoses SEO health from a bot's perspective, checking for broken links, duplicate content, and missing meta tags. Another freemium approach is offered by platforms like Yoast SEO, a WordPress plugin that provides seamless on-page optimization guidance directly within the content editor. Starting with these free and freemium tools allows one to build a solid foundation and understand the core principles of SEO before graduating to more advanced, paid solutions.
The Impact of AI and Automation
The integration of Artificial Intelligence is arguably the most significant shift in the SEO tool landscape in 2025. AI is no longer a futuristic concept but a practical component of modern SEO workflows, primarily focused on scaling content production intelligently and automating tedious tasks. This has led to the emergence of tools that leverage machine learning to offer capabilities far beyond simple data reporting.
AI-powered content optimization tools, such as Clearscope, analyze top-ranking content for a given keyword and provide recommendations to improve relevance and ranking potential. This often involves suggesting related terms, semantic topics, and optimal content length, effectively guiding the writer to create comprehensive, high-quality content. Similarly, general-purpose AI models like ChatGPT are used extensively for brainstorming ideas, refining SEO strategies, and even drafting initial content outlines.
Automation is another key area where AI is making an impact. Tools like Gumloop allow users to create automated SEO workflows, reducing the manual labor involved in tasks like data aggregation or reporting. This frees up valuable time for strategic thinking and creative execution. The overarching theme is that modern SEO strategies are increasingly about leveraging data-driven decisions and automating repetitive processes. The tools that reflect this new reality—those that incorporate AI for content enhancement and workflow automation—are becoming essential for maintaining a competitive edge.
Summary of Tool Categories
To synthesize the information, the SEO tool ecosystem can be broadly categorized based on their primary function. Understanding these categories helps in building a balanced "stack" of tools that covers all aspects of an SEO campaign.
| Category | Primary Function | Example Tools |
|---|---|---|
| All-in-One Suites | Comprehensive analysis across SEO, PPC, content, and social media. | Semrush, Ahrefs, Moz Pro |
| Keyword Research | Identifying search terms, volume, difficulty, and user intent. | Keyword Insights, Google Keyword Planner, Keywords Everywhere |
| Technical Audit & Crawling | Analyzing website health, crawl errors, and site structure. | Screaming Frog, Google Search Console |
| Content Optimization | Improving content relevance and quality based on top-ranking pages. | Clearscope, Yoast SEO, Surfer |
| Rank Tracking | Monitoring keyword positions over time for specific URLs/domains. | Fatrank, Semrush Position Tracking |
| Link Building & Outreach | Finding link opportunities and managing outreach campaigns. | Featured, BuzzStream |
| Trend Analysis | Identifying rising topics and market trends. | Exploding Topics, Google Trends |
| AI & Automation | Automating workflows and generating content strategies. | ChatGPT, Gumloop |
This categorization demonstrates that there is no single "best" tool. Instead, the most effective SEO practitioners combine tools from different categories to create a workflow that is both efficient and comprehensive. A typical workflow might involve using Google Trends to spot a trend, Keyword Insights to cluster related terms, Clearscope to optimize the content, Screaming Frog to ensure technical quality, and Semrush to track the resulting rankings.
Frequently Asked Questions
Navigating the world of SEO tools often brings up several practical questions. Here are answers to some of the most common inquiries.
What is the best SEO tool for a complete beginner? For a beginner, the best approach is to start with the free tools provided by Google, specifically Google Search Console and Google Keyword Planner. These tools provide foundational data and are essential for understanding how a website interacts with the search engine. Once comfortable, a user might explore a freemium tool like Screaming Frog for technical audits or a Chrome extension like Keywords Everywhere for on-the-go keyword ideas.
Can I rely solely on free SEO tools? Yes, it is possible to achieve strong results using only free tools, especially for smaller websites or personal blogs. Many experts have ranked #1 for competitive terms by mastering Google's free offerings. However, as a website grows and competition increases, paid tools become almost necessary for tasks like deep backlink analysis, competitor monitoring, and large-scale site crawling.
How do AI-powered SEO tools differ from traditional ones? Traditional SEO tools primarily focus on data collection and reporting (e.g., search volume, backlinks, rankings). AI-powered tools, on the other hand, often provide prescriptive recommendations and automation. For example, an AI tool might analyze content and suggest specific semantic terms to include (Clearscope), automate the creation of SEO reports (Gumloop), or help brainstorm content angles based on trending data (Exploding Topics).
How many SEO tools do I really need? The number of tools needed varies. A solo freelancer might be perfectly equipped with an all-in-one tool like Semrush, a technical crawler like Screaming Frog, and a few free browser extensions. An agency managing dozens of clients will likely need a more robust stack, including specialized outreach platforms like BuzzStream and automated reporting systems.
The Strategic Selection Process
Selecting the right SEO tools is not about finding a single "best" application, but about constructing a toolkit that aligns with your specific goals, budget, and workflow. The landscape is vast, ranging from the indispensable free utilities offered by search engines to sophisticated, AI-driven all-in-one platforms. The key is to understand the function of each tool category and how they complement one another. A successful SEO campaign relies on data at every stage: identifying opportunities through keyword research, analyzing the competitive landscape, creating high-quality and relevant content, ensuring technical soundness, and building authority through links.
As the search environment continues to evolve with the integration of AI, the tools that offer automation and deeper, more predictive insights will become increasingly valuable. However, the fundamental principles remain unchanged. The best tool is the one that empowers you to make better decisions and execute your strategy more efficiently. Whether you begin with the free offerings from Google or invest in a comprehensive suite like Semrush, the most important step is to start using these tools to gather data, analyze performance, and continuously optimize your digital presence for both traditional and AI-powered search engines.